First Printed Vulgate with woodcuts throughout. Includes the typical details of Vulgate Bibles at the time: printed initials, chapter numbers, book headlines, foliation, marginal references, chapter subdivisions, and additional readers' aids.

<p>In Bridwell Library’s copy of the 1584<span> </span><em>Biblia Sacra</em><span> </span>compiled by Franciscus Vatablus, note 20 on Psalm 16 was expurgated after the words “deseres animam meam,” and note 22 was deleted entirely. Although these expurgations match those dictated by Sotomayor’s<span> </span><em>Index</em>,<span> </span><span>inscriptions</span><span> </span>in both volumes of the<span> </span><em>Biblia Sacra</em><span> </span>indicate that the expurgations were made by Diego León Plaza, censor of the Inquisition, in accordance with an earlier Spanish<span> </span><em>Index librorum expurgatorum</em>, compiled in 1612 for Bernardo de Sandoval y Rojas, the Archbishop of Toledo.</p>
